Fun Upcycling Crafts for Children and Eco-Conscious Activities
Teaching children about the importance of sustainability and caring for the environment can be both fun and educational. Engaging kids in upcycling crafts and eco-conscious activities not only sparks their creativity but also instills in them a sense of responsibility towards the planet. Here are some exciting ideas to get started!
1. Toilet Paper Roll Animals

Transform empty toilet paper rolls into cute animals by painting and decorating them with paper, googly eyes, and markers. This craft not only repurposes waste but also allows kids to unleash their imagination.
2. Plastic Bottle Planters

Cut plastic bottles in half, decorate them with paint or stickers, and use them as planters for small herbs or flowers. This activity teaches children about the importance of recycling plastic and caring for plants.
3. Newspaper Hats

Old newspapers can be turned into stylish hats with a few folds and twists. Encourage kids to get creative with designs and colors, promoting the reuse of paper items.
4. Egg Carton Caterpillars

Paint empty egg cartons in vibrant colors, add googly eyes and pipe cleaners, and create adorable caterpillars. This craft not only recycles egg cartons but also teaches kids about insects and colors.
5. Nature Scavenger Hunt

Take children on a nature scavenger hunt to collect items like leaves, rocks, and flowers. This activity fosters a love for the outdoors and raises awareness about the beauty of nature.
